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Data processing method and device

A data processing and database technology, applied in the field of neural networks, can solve problems such as the small number of correct matches, wrong feature matches, and reduce the accuracy of relocation, so as to achieve the effect of improving attitude information

Pending Publication Date: 2020-09-29
ALIBABA GRP HLDG LTD
View PDF0 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] Existing visual relocalization techniques mostly use traditional local features, such as scale-invariant feature transform (SIFT). However, when the light difference between the offline map and the real running scene is large, traditional local features are used Feature matching and searching for features are easy to introduce wrong feature matches, or the number of correct matches is small, thereby reducing the accuracy of relocation

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data processing method and device
  • Data processing method and device
  • Data processing method and device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0058]In order to make the purpose, technical solutions and advantages of the embodiments of the present invention clearer, the technical solutions in the embodiments of the present invention will be clearly and completely described below in conjunction with the drawings in the embodiments of the present invention. Obviously, the described embodiments It is a part of embodiments of the present invention, but not all embodiments. Based on the embodiments of the present invention, all other embodiments obtained by persons of ordinary skill in the art without making creative efforts belong to the protection scope of the present invention.

[0059] Terms used in the embodiments of the present invention are only for the purpose of describing specific embodiments, and are not intended to limit the present invention. The singular forms "a", "said" and "the" used in the embodiments of the present invention and the appended claims are also intended to include plural forms, unless the c...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a data processing method and device. A place database is pre-constructed by adopting a deep neural network; all features and local features of a key frame image in the locationdatabase are obtained by deep learning of a deep neural network. In the deep neural network learning, it is assumed that the descriptor of the local feature of the key frame image has a certain degreeof light variability, so that when the light change is large, the key frame image can be accurately matched in the place database despite the large change of the descriptor of the local feature of the first image.

Description

technical field [0001] The invention relates to the technical field of neural networks, in particular to a data processing method and device. Background technique [0002] For small intelligent robots, visual relocation technology plays an important role. Relocation refers to: when the robot's positioning fails, the robot compares the three-dimensional map of the operating environment established offline to retrieve the current robot's position and posture. , so as to ensure the normal operation of the robot. [0003] Usually, the cause of robot positioning failure is generally caused by human or environmental interference factors during actual operation. For example: the camera of the robot is temporarily blocked by people, resulting in no effective visual information, the robot is abducted or forced to move its position, and the robot passes through places with strong changes in indoor and outdoor light, etc. After the interference factors are removed, the robot needs to...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06T7/73G06F16/583
CPCG06T7/74G06F16/583G06T2207/20081G06T2207/20084G06T2207/30252
Inventor 韩煦深梅佳胡超杜承垚刘宝龙孙凯李名杨
Owner ALIBABA GRP HLDG L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products